The Jacques Hadamard Mathematical Foundation (FMJH) is a key player in fundamental research in mathematics, founded by the CNRS, the École Polytechnique, the ENS Paris Saclay, the Institut des Hautes Études Scientifiques and the University of Paris-Saclay.
By supporting the Jacques Hadamard Mathematical Foundation, the Michelin Corporate Foundation contributes to accelerating interactions between fundamental research, businesses and emerging disciplines.
Faced with the observation that women only represent 20% of doctoral graduates each year in mathematics, the FMJH has launched a call for applications in 2024 to obtain 10 scholarships, in order to enable young female students to pursue their studies up to the doctorate.
Wishing to promote diversity in this field of excellence and encourage female talents, the Michelin Corporate Foundation has joined forces with the FMJH in this approach, and has awarded four scholarships in 2024 to young female students in order to support for 3 years, from the license to the doctorate.
